From 394191b36f04b594d6f5dc7dd9f6d482b84e4bbc Mon Sep 17 00:00:00 2001 From: Stefan Kuhn Date: Fri, 20 Jul 2012 09:57:51 +0200 Subject: adding www-apache/mod_wsgi 9999.ebuild --- www-apache/mod_wsgi/Manifest | 3 ++ www-apache/mod_wsgi/files/70_mod_wsgi.conf | 5 ++++ www-apache/mod_wsgi/metadata.xml | 12 ++++++++ www-apache/mod_wsgi/mod_wsgi-9999.ebuild | 45 ++++++++++++++++++++++++++++++ 4 files changed, 65 insertions(+) create mode 100644 www-apache/mod_wsgi/Manifest create mode 100644 www-apache/mod_wsgi/files/70_mod_wsgi.conf create mode 100644 www-apache/mod_wsgi/metadata.xml create mode 100644 www-apache/mod_wsgi/mod_wsgi-9999.ebuild diff --git a/www-apache/mod_wsgi/Manifest b/www-apache/mod_wsgi/Manifest new file mode 100644 index 0000000..7ea7837 --- /dev/null +++ b/www-apache/mod_wsgi/Manifest @@ -0,0 +1,3 @@ +AUX 70_mod_wsgi.conf 100 RMD160 60c74317eded93c727cc5ebb74e33f1e040d4187 SHA1 cf23e48a59c624cfc021dda43f3d16a899f4be3a SHA256 a4c1b49eb8c6d6609ad8ae8a9f8d6621f9f2bbc2c99addef3e2d6404ac364ed7 +EBUILD mod_wsgi-9999.ebuild 877 RMD160 f321ec82a0b8871391dccce3660ddab150480f0b SHA1 b4234d84e22a666a6ee7beb9c2ca8313c0bd11ab SHA256 929a243ae4da59b48fd3db85ddec64c344e45bc97b6d1f747eb784a77f5ff67d +MISC metadata.xml 329 RMD160 412cac15e9ba6e99c777189614ce1b39b4c13ed7 SHA1 9517e1f536f4e680c0cfa0299980f95a86a51ea3 SHA256 f1cf1f56ee39fe4faed1af70d24b369040e395e3fe8ce95f7f9c0394ec5cde6c diff --git a/www-apache/mod_wsgi/files/70_mod_wsgi.conf b/www-apache/mod_wsgi/files/70_mod_wsgi.conf new file mode 100644 index 0000000..3fabc59 --- /dev/null +++ b/www-apache/mod_wsgi/files/70_mod_wsgi.conf @@ -0,0 +1,5 @@ + +LoadModule wsgi_module modules/mod_wsgi.so + + +# vim: ts=4 filetype=apache diff --git a/www-apache/mod_wsgi/metadata.xml b/www-apache/mod_wsgi/metadata.xml new file mode 100644 index 0000000..7a75945 --- /dev/null +++ b/www-apache/mod_wsgi/metadata.xml @@ -0,0 +1,12 @@ + + + + apache + + djc@gentoo.org + Dirkjan Ochtman + + + modwsgi + + diff --git a/www-apache/mod_wsgi/mod_wsgi-9999.ebuild b/www-apache/mod_wsgi/mod_wsgi-9999.ebuild new file mode 100644 index 0000000..8a7ca57 --- /dev/null +++ b/www-apache/mod_wsgi/mod_wsgi-9999.ebuild @@ -0,0 +1,45 @@ +# Copyright 1999-2011 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/www-apache/mod_wsgi/mod_wsgi-3.3.ebuild,v 1.5 2011/04/22 21:58:23 arfrever Exp $ + +EAPI="3" +PYTHON_DEPEND="*" +PYTHON_USE_WITH="threads" + +inherit apache-module eutils python mercurial + +DESCRIPTION="An Apache2 module for running Python WSGI applications." +HOMEPAGE="http://code.google.com/p/modwsgi/" +EHG_REPO_URI="https://code.google.com/p/modwsgi" + +LICENSE="Apache-2.0" +SLOT="0" +KEYWORDS="~amd64" +IUSE="" + +DEPEND="" +RDEPEND="" + +APACHE2_MOD_CONF="70_${PN}" +APACHE2_MOD_DEFINE="WSGI" + +DOCFILES="README" + +need_apache2 +S="${WORKDIR}/${PN}" + +src_configure() { + cd "${S}/${PN}" + econf --with-apxs=${APXS} +} + +src_compile() { + cd "${S}/${PN}" + default +} + +src_install() +{ + cd "${S}/${PN}" + emake DESTDIR="${D}" install || die "Install failed" +} -- cgit v1.2.3-65-gdbad